TRUTH OR CONSEQUENCES, New Mexico (Reuters) - Actor James Doohan,
who played the starship Enterprise's chief engineer Scotty on "Star Trek,"
finally made it to space Saturday as a rocket with some of his ashes was
launched in New Mexico.
Remains of the Canadian-born actor, who died two years ago at the age
of 85, hurtled to the edge of space aboard a telephone pole-size rocket
that blasted off from a desert launching grounds near Truth or Consequences....
